Spanish and French scientists made a determination of the speed of sound close to Quito (Ecuador) in 1738. There was a particular interest in this measurement at that time because it was thought that the proximity of the Equator and the great altitude would have a major influence on this magnitude. The difference in time between the perceptions of the flash of a gunshot and of the corresponding sound was measured at two different sites. At one of them, Jorge Juan and Louis Godin obtained a value of 341 m/s for the speed of sound, and at the other, Antonio de Ulloa and Pierre Bouguer deduced a value of 348 m/s. Juan and Ulloa published these experiments in their book "Observaciones Astronomicas y Phisicas" (1748). They also presented possible applications of these studies of sound propagation to geometry, navigation, and warfare. (C) 2003 Elsevier Ltd. All rights reserved.
